Africa-Focused Chui Ventures Closes First Fund At $17m

Africa-focused early-stage investor Chui Ventures has closed its first fund at $17.3 million and announced plans for a second vehicle targeting $60 million. The firm backs seed-stage startups across the continent with a gender-inclusive investment strategy. Local start-up closes indigenous language gap in edtech

Limu Lab’s interactive app aims to help children learn South Africa’s indigenous languages. South African start-up Limu Lab has launched a language-learning app to make isiZulu and other indigenous languages accessible to children through games, animations and storytelling. Meta closes child abuse accounts after SA court order

Possessing, distributing or creating child sexual abuse material is illegal. Meta has shut down several WhatsApp and Instagram accounts in compliance with a court order over sexually explicit content being shared via the social media channel.
